KidConnect: Community Childcare App

The mobile app "KidConnect" addresses the challenge of coordinating childcare among busy parents by facilitating a secure platform for parents to share trusted babysitters and nannies within their community. Targeting busy working parents, particularly in urban areas, the app allows users to rate and review caregivers, share schedules, and even offer group childcare options, creating a collaborative network for childcare solutions. What makes KidConnect unique is its integrated AI feature that suggests optimal caregivers based on a family’s specific needs, preferences, and past experiences, fostering a personalized approach to childcare.

Competition Analysis

Score: 65/100

Several apps offer childcare matching services, but few focus on community-based sharing and AI-driven personalization. Competitors include Care.com and UrbanSitter, which focus more on marketplace models.

Care.com

A platform for finding caregivers across various services.

Strengths: Established brand, Large user base

Weaknesses: Generic service, High fees

UrbanSitter

A platform connecting parents with babysitters recommended by friends.

Strengths: Social recommendation system

Weaknesses: Limited AI integration, Higher cost for premium features
